摘要
文章运用Maple语言程序,在没有假设的条件下,得到了α螺旋蛋白质螺旋链运动模型方程组的行波精确解组,它涵盖了所有的耦合解组与非耦合解组,具有任意性。耦合解组的算例函数及其特性分析,解释了α螺旋蛋白质螺旋链运动模型的行波孤立子解的耦合效应,揭示了增加、稳定和控制蛋白质活性和功能的方向,文章的研究方法,为求解生物大分子螺旋链运动模型的行波精确解组探索了溪径。
The author utilizes Maple language process to find the traveling wave accurate solutions of helix chain model of the alpha-helix protein without assumptions and that its expression is arbitrary and covers all coupling solutions and non-coupling solutions. The calculation cases and their characteristic analysis of coupling solutions explain the coupling effect of traveling wave soliton solutions of the helix chain movement model of the alpha-helix protein and reveal the direction which increases and fixes and controls the protein activation and function. The research methods in this paper provide ways for the traveling wave accurate solutions of the life-form brand molecule helix chain movement model.
